What customers say
This budget friendly cable earns high praise as a reliable alternative for PC VR gaming. Users value the generous 10 foot length for enhanced movement and appreciate the durable build quality, especially the angled connector that minimizes headset port strain. The core strength is its exceptional value, delivering near premium Link functionality affordably. A few users note minor performance variability, including occasional disconnects during intense sessions. Furthermore, buyers should know the cable generally maintains battery life during play rather than actively charging the headset. Overall, it is highly recommended for Quest users seeking cost effective PC VR expansion.

Yes, this cable is fully compatible with both the original Oculus Quest and the Quest 2, as well as the Rift S.
The amplifier chip is essential for maintaining a stable, high-speed data connection over a 16-foot distance. It prevents signal degradation, ensuring you experience smooth, lag-free gameplay without data loss.
No, the 90-degree angle is designed for durability and ergonomics. It keeps the cable flush against the headset, which reduces strain on the port and prevents the cable from sticking out and getting snagged during active movement.
While the cable facilitates data transfer for PC VR, it also allows for charging. However, the actual charging speed will depend on the power output of your PC's USB port.
The hangers help you organize your cable setup by securing it to your ceiling or walls. This keeps the cord off the floor, preventing tripping hazards and allowing for a more immersive, tangle-free VR experience.
